Muffler System Maintenance and Optimization
Maintaining a vehicle’s exhaust system is crucial for optimal performance, fuel efficiency, and regulatory compliance. Adhering to established best practices can extend the lifespan of components and prevent costly repairs.
Tip 1: Regular Visual Inspections: Conduct routine examinations of the exhaust system, including the muffler, tailpipe, and connecting pipes. Look for signs of rust, corrosion, physical damage, or leaks, which can compromise system integrity.
Tip 2: Prompt Leak Detection and Repair: Address any detected exhaust leaks immediately. Exhaust leaks can release harmful gases into the vehicle cabin, reduce engine performance, and increase noise levels.
Tip 3: Scheduled Muffler Replacement: Follow manufacturer-recommended replacement intervals for mufflers. A failing muffler can negatively impact fuel economy, increase noise pollution, and potentially lead to more extensive exhaust system damage.
Tip 4: Catalytic Converter Monitoring: Ensure the catalytic converter is functioning correctly. A malfunctioning converter can result in increased emissions, decreased fuel efficiency, and potential engine damage. Diagnostic testing can confirm converter health.
Tip 5: Proper Component Selection: When replacing exhaust system components, choose high-quality parts designed for the specific vehicle make and model. Using substandard components can lead to premature failure and reduced performance.
Tip 6: Professional Installation: Ensure all exhaust system work is performed by qualified technicians. Incorrect installation can lead to leaks, component damage, and reduced system efficiency.
Adherence to these guidelines can promote the longevity and efficient operation of a vehicle’s exhaust system, contributing to improved performance and regulatory compliance.

2. Muffler Replacement Cost
Muffler replacement cost, when considered within the context of automotive service providers in Waycross, Georgia, represents a significant variable impacting consumer decisions and business operations. Understanding the factors influencing this cost is crucial for both vehicle owners seeking services and businesses striving to offer competitive pricing.
- Vehicle Type and Model
The make, model, and year of a vehicle directly affect muffler replacement cost. Different vehicles require different muffler designs, materials, and installation procedures. For example, a high-performance sports car may necessitate a specialized, more expensive muffler compared to a standard sedan. The availability of parts and the complexity of the exhaust system for a particular model further contribute to price variations in Waycross shops.
- Muffler Material and Quality
The material composition and overall quality of the muffler influence its cost. Mufflers are typically constructed from aluminized steel, stainless steel, or other specialized alloys. Stainless steel mufflers, offering greater durability and resistance to corrosion, generally command a higher price. Local businesses in Waycross must balance offering cost-effective options with providing durable, long-lasting solutions to cater to a range of customer needs and budgets.
- Labor Rates at Waycross, GA Service Providers
Labor costs constitute a significant portion of the overall muffler replacement expense. Hourly labor rates can vary among different service providers in Waycross, GA, depending on factors such as shop size, technician experience, and overhead expenses. The complexity of the installation process also affects labor time, with some vehicles requiring more extensive disassembly or modifications. Therefore, obtaining quotes from multiple shops is advisable to compare labor charges.
- Warranty and Additional Services
The inclusion of a warranty on the muffler and installation work affects the total cost. A longer warranty period can provide peace of mind but may also increase the initial price. Furthermore, additional services, such as exhaust system inspections or the replacement of related components like pipes or hangers, can contribute to the overall expense. Waycross establishments may offer package deals or discounts that combine muffler replacement with these supplementary services.

5. Certified Technicians Available
The availability of certified technicians at a muffler shop within Waycross, Georgia, is a critical factor determining the quality and reliability of automotive services provided. Certification indicates a technician’s adherence to industry standards and demonstrated competence in performing specific repairs. Its presence directly impacts customer trust and the reputation of the business.
- Demonstrated Expertise and Skills
Certification programs, such as those offered by ASE (Automotive Service Excellence), require technicians to pass rigorous examinations and demonstrate practical skills in their respective areas of expertise. At a Waycross muffler shop, certified technicians possess the knowledge to diagnose exhaust system issues accurately and perform repairs effectively. This expertise minimizes the risk of improper repairs or misdiagnosis, leading to improved customer satisfaction and vehicle performance. For example, a technician certified in exhaust systems is more likely to correctly identify and repair a catalytic converter problem, ensuring the vehicle meets emissions standards.
- Adherence to Industry Best Practices
Certification mandates ongoing training and adherence to industry best practices. Certified technicians remain current with evolving automotive technologies and repair procedures. This commitment to continuous learning ensures that Waycross muffler shops employing certified technicians can offer services aligned with the latest industry standards. Staying abreast of the most recent service bulletins, vehicle recalls, and O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) specifications is vital.
- Enhanced Diagnostic Accuracy
Exhaust system problems can be complex and require accurate diagnostics to determine the root cause. Certified technicians possess the diagnostic tools and expertise to effectively identify issues ranging from minor leaks to significant structural damage. A skilled diagnostician can distinguish between a simple muffler replacement and a more extensive exhaust system repair, potentially saving customers time and money. Without this expertise, technicians are more likely to rely on trial-and-error methods, which can lead to incorrect repairs and recurring problems.
- Customer Confidence and Trust
The presence of certified technicians at a muffler shop in Waycross, GA, fosters greater customer confidence. Certification provides tangible assurance that the technicians possess the necessary skills and knowledge to perform reliable repairs. Customers are more likely to entrust their vehicles to a shop with certified technicians, knowing that their vehicles are in capable hands. This trust leads to increased customer loyalty and positive word-of-mouth referrals, contributing to the shop’s overall success.

Frequently Asked Questions
The following addresses prevalent inquiries regarding exhaust system services provided by automotive businesses located in Waycross, Georgia.
Question 1: What is the typical lifespan of a muffler?
The lifespan of a muffler varies depending on factors such as driving conditions, climate, and the quality of the muffler itself. Under normal circumstances, a muffler can last between five and seven years. However, exposure to road salt, frequent short trips, or aggressive driving habits can significantly reduce its lifespan.
Question 2: How does one identify a failing catalytic converter?
Symptoms of a failing catalytic converter include reduced engine performance, decreased fuel efficiency, a sulfur-like odor emanating from the exhaust, and illumination of the check engine light. A professional diagnostic test is required to confirm catalytic converter failure.
Question 3: What are the potential consequences of driving with an exhaust leak?
Driving with an exhaust leak can lead to decreased fuel efficiency, reduced engine power, increased noise pollution, and potential exposure to harmful gases inside the vehicle cabin. Furthermore, exhaust leaks can cause damage to other vehicle components and may result in failing an emissions test.
Question 4: Is it necessary to replace the entire exhaust system when only the muffler is damaged?
No, it is not always necessary to replace the entire exhaust system when only the muffler is damaged. However, a thorough inspection of the entire exhaust system is recommended to identify any other potential issues, such as rusted pipes or damaged hangers. Replacing multiple worn components simultaneously can often save on labor costs.
Question 5: What factors influence the cost of muffler replacement?
The cost of muffler replacement depends on the vehicle’s make and model, the type of muffler selected (e.g., standard, performance, stainless steel), and the labor rates charged by the service provider. High-performance mufflers and complex installations typically command a higher price.
Question 6: How often should an exhaust system be inspected?
An exhaust system should be inspected at least annually, or whenever a potential issue is suspected. Regular inspections can identify problems early, preventing costly repairs and ensuring optimal vehicle performance.
